Shepherd of the Hills Lutheran Church Hosts Texas 4000 Cyclists

Shepherd of the Hills Lutheran church in Gunbarrel will once again host the Texas 4000 cyclists on June 23-24 as they pedal from Austin, Texas to Anchorage, Alaska. Each member of the cycling teams has either had a personal battle with cancer, or has had someone close to them affected. This ride is the longest charity ride in the world and raises money for the American Cancer Society. During the journey, the cyclists visit hospitalized cancer patients to provide support and share their experiences. To read more about this effort, visit www.Texas4000.org. Shepherd of the Hills will welcome the cyclists on June 23 by serving dinner and providing overnight lodging.
